Embracing Recovery: A Comprehensive Approach to Dual Diagnosis
Living with a dual diagnosis can feel overwhelming. It often presents unique challenges, as you navigate two separate conditions simultaneously. But it's essential to remember that recovery is possible, and there are proven strategies to help you reclaim your life.
The key lies in seeking specialized treatment that addresses both diagnoses. Counselors specializing in dual diagnosis can create a customized plan designed to meet your individual needs. This might comprise a combination of therapies, such as c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), and medication management.
It's also crucial to build a robust support system. Connecting with friends who understand your journey can provide invaluable motivation. Joining support groups for people with dual diagnoses can also offer a sense of community and shared experience.
